If it is a WOW factor you are after, then LOOK NO FURTHER! A superb opportunity to purchase this exquisite seven bedroom, flint fronted, detached 18th century family home! Situated on the outskirts of Arundel, this stunning property is set on approximately one acre of land and is beautifully presented inside and out, boasting seven spacious bedrooms with five of the rooms featuring modern en-suite bath/shower rooms, including a ground floor bedroom. There is a large detached triple garage which has the potential to be converted into an annexe, or office/studio and the private garden is mostly laid to lawn and enjoys picturesque views across open farmland. There are also two outbuildings comprising a large stable block, and a woodshed with power supply. The property is accessed by an electrically gated private entrance which leads onto a driveway offering secure parking for several vehicles. First erected around 1790 and then re-built in 1881, set on approximately 1 acre of land and enjoying stunning rural views across farmland, this flint fronted, 7 bedroom detached property is not one to miss out on!

Ground floor features include a spacious and bright kitchen breakfast room, a utility room and WC. dining hall/family room with a log burner, a study/guest bedroom with a modern en-suite. The "quadruple aspect" living room is a breath-taking space with an eye-catching fireplace & double doors opening out to the lawned garden and enjoying views across the garden & adjoining farmland.

On the first floor there are a further four en-suite bedrooms, including a stunning, vaulted Master Bedroom Suite, with extensive far-reaching countryside views, spacious bath & wet room en-suite & a separate dressing room - and there are two further bedrooms sharing a family bathroom.

In the garden, for separate negotiation with the vendor, is a Lynx helicopter which has been converted into a "man-cave" - this helicopter is the actual one that Airfix surveyed to deliver its Lynx model aircraft to build. Whilst no longer flight capable, most electrical systems including lights and radios are still working, it has wifi, heating/cooling, 4 flat screens including a large cinematic screen connected to a Dolby 9.1 surround sound system. There is also a pull-down sofa bed for overnight camping.

Included in the sale is a large enclosed "Jungle Jim" playground built to commercial standard, comprising multiple climbing frames, swings, slides, playhouse, climbing walls, trampoline and sandpit. There is also a 40 metre zipline stretching from the playground across the garden.

There is also a brick and slate pig house dating from the 1920's (in very good condition) which has a multitude of potential uses.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
